Biography

Dr. Andrew Tice is a well-respected surgeon at the Children’s Hospital Eastern Ontario, specializing in pediatric orthopedic trauma and spine deformity. He completed his medical degree at the University of Alberta and furthered his training through an orthopedic residency at the University of Ottawa. Dr. Tice advanced his expertise with a pediatric orthopedic fellowship at the Texas Scottish Rite Hospital for Children in Dallas, Texas, and a Spine Scoliosis Fellowship at McGill University. His contributions to the field of orthopedics, especially in areas concerning pediatric care, have been significant, making him a leader in treating complex spine conditions in children. Dr. Tice is dedicated to advancing the field of pediatric orthopedic surgery through both clinical practice and research.
